As a Tuck student, I attended a Tuck board of overseers dinner and came out with a mentor to die for: Christina Steiner Shea T'77, president of the General Mills Foundation and senior vice president of General Mills, Inc. I couldn't believe her willingness to listen and advise. But then again, this is Tuck.

Within a few minutes of meeting, Christina Shea and I connected in a way that was incredibly helpful. She advised me throughout the recruiting process. Her knowledge and experience proved to be an amazing resource. She was accessible and examined different employment options with me. In the end I accepted a position with Time Warner in New York City, working to establish brands of some of their magazines. The company is so varied that I have gotten a great diversity of experiences.

I had a strong marketing background before applying to business schools, but as an undergraduate art history/history double major, I really wanted the solid general management education that I knew I would get at Tuck.
